Types Of Tenses

Tenses: Tense means ‘time’

Types of Tenses:-

  • There are ‘3’ types of tenses based on time.
  • Tenses are divided in to ‘3’ types.
  • Present Tense.
  • Past Tense.
  • Future Tense.

Each ‘Tense’ is sub divided in to ‘4’ types.

Present Tense:
Simple present tense: sub+v1(s/es)+obj.

                                Ex: I work as doctor.                                      

Present continuous tense: sub+Is/Am/Are+V4+obj

                    Ex: I am working as doctor.

Present perfect tense: sub+Has/Have +V3 +obj

                       Ex: I have worked as doctor.

Present perfect continuous tense: sub+Has been/Have been+V4+obj

              Ex: I have been working as doctor.

Past Tense:
1) Simple past tense: sub+V2+obj.
                          Ex: I worked as doctor

2)Past continuous: sub+was/were+V4 +obj.    

                         Ex: I was working as doctor.

3)Past perfect: sub+Had+v3 +obj.     

           Ex: I had worked as doctor.

4)Past perfect continuous: sub+Had been/+V4+obj.

                         Ex:I had been working as doctor.

Future Tense:

1)Future simple tense: sub+will/Shall+v1+obj.

                              Ex: I will work as doctor.

                                           (or)

                                   I shall work as doctor.

2)Future continuous tense: sub+will be/ shall be+v4 obj.                      

                                  Ex:I will be working as doctor.                         

3)Future perfect tense: sub+will have/ shall have+V3 obj.                                        

                   Ex: I will have worked as doctor.

 4)Future perfect continuous tense: sub+will have been/shall have been+V4                    

      Ex: I will have been working as doctor.
